The Man Behind the Mask: Stefan Karl Stefánsson
You might already know this, but in case you don't, the actor who brought Robbie Rotten to life is none other than Stefan Karl Stefánsson. Born on July 10, 1975, in Reykjavík, Iceland, Stefan is an accomplished actor, comedian, and musician. Stefan's Journey to LazyTown
Before LazyTown, Stefan was already a well-known figure in Iceland's entertainment scene. He had appeared in various TV shows and movies, honing his craft and making a name for himself. His big break came when he was cast as Robbie Rotten in the children's television series LazyTown, which was created by Icelandic musician and composer Magnús Scheving.
The show was an instant hit, and Stefan's portrayal of the lovable villain quickly became a fan favorite. Stefan's Battle with Cancer
In 2016, Stefan was diagnosed with bile duct cancer, which had spread to his lymph nodes. The news of his illness sent shockwaves through the LazyTown community, and fans from all over the world rallied around him, sending messages of love and support.
Stefan faced his battle with courage and determination, using his platform to raise awareness about cancer and the importance of early detection. He continued to act and perform throughout his treatment, inspiring fans with his strength and resilience.
Sadly, Stefan passed away on August 21, 2018, at the age of 43. His death left a void in the hearts of LazyTown fans everywhere, but his legacy lives on through his iconic performance as Robbie Rotten.
